Understanding the B3801 Code Definition
The B3801 code indicates an issue with the Passenger Compartment Lamp Request Circuit. This code triggers when the system detects a malfunction in the circuitry responsible for controlling the interior lights based on driver or passenger requests.
Common symptoms include non-functioning interior lights or lights that operate sporadically. To diagnose the B3801 code effectively, begin by visually inspecting the wiring and connectors associated with the passenger compartment lamp. Look for any signs of damage, corrosion, or loose connections that could disrupt the electrical flow.
Use a multimeter to test the circuit’s continuity. Check for voltage at the lamp and confirm that the circuit completes properly when the switch is activated. If the power supply is consistent, examine the lamp itself, as a burned-out bulb can trigger the code. Replace any faulty components found during the inspection.
Once repairs are made, clear the trouble code using an OBD-II scanner and monitor the system for reoccurrence. If the issue persists, further testing may be required to identify deeper electrical faults or module failures that could be the root cause of the problem.

Common Causes of B3801 Triggering
Check for issues with the passenger compartment lamp switch. A malfunctioning or stuck switch often leads to false signals, triggering the B3801 code. Inspect the switch’s wiring for damage or corrosion, as these can disrupt the electrical flow.
Evaluate the vehicle’s wiring harness. Frayed, damaged, or improperly connected wires can cause intermittent faults in the circuit. Look for any signs of wear, especially in areas prone to movement or abrasion.
Inspect the lamp itself. A burned-out bulb can sometimes lead to erroneous readings in the system, causing the B3801 code to trigger. Replace any faulty bulbs and verify that all connections are secure.
Check the body control module (BCM). Software glitches or malfunctions in the BCM can misinterpret signals from the passenger compartment lamp circuit. Consider recalibrating or updating the BCM’s software if applicable.
Look for water intrusion. Moisture can enter the passenger compartment and affect electrical components, including the lamp circuit. Ensure that seals around doors and windows are intact and leak-free.

Using a Multimeter for Testing
To test the B3801 – Passenger Compartment Lamp Request Circuit, begin with your multimeter set to the DC voltage setting. Connect the black probe to a known ground point, like the vehicle’s chassis, and the red probe to the lamp request circuit wire. A reading of approximately 12 volts indicates a proper circuit operation, while a significantly lower value suggests a potential issue.
Checking Continuity
Switch the multimeter to the continuity test mode. Disconnect the circuit from the power source, then place probes on both ends of the circuit. A beep sound confirms continuity; if there’s no beep, inspect for breaks or loose connections in the wiring.
Measuring Resistance
For resistance checks, turn off the circuit power, then set the multimeter to the resistance mode. Connect the probes to the lamp socket terminals. The expected resistance value should align with the manufacturer specifications. An infinite reading indicates an open circuit, while a value significantly lower than expected points to a short circuit.
